Transaction 21e73d02bbc239914a54dfa5c87aac1bf54b6974813925a3e0017e5c21022e8a
1 Input
1 Output
-
21e73d02bbc239914a54dfa5c87aac1bf54b6974813925a3e0017e5c21022e8a:0
- value
- 240070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ebb61ba893ad15b20f86131b4ce782904e9843fa OP_EQUAL
- address
- 3PBLsiGphBuT9Cbbbn8xMYJKku678yWGHt